AnnotationAccording to the Hospital Advisory Service, the "swap" system - the method of exchanging one place in a residential care home for one in a hospital - is still operating in many areas. The author suggests that assessment of older people's medical and social needs is the first step to overcoming this problem. The community also has to learn to care. (RH).
